The petty knife is a cross between a paring knife and small utility.

Great for tasks like mincing garlic and ginger, with a little extra length this petty knife is a helpful tool in the kitchen. It’s ideal for rounded and thin-skinned fruit and vegetables. Its small size gives you complete control over the tip and edge of the blade.

Kai Benifuji is part of the Seki Magoroku range of knives. Many celebrated swords were born in the Seki area and in the Kamakura era. The master craftsman “Magoroku of Seki” had the original technique of producing beautiful swords which were high quality and had outstanding sharpness. Made in Japan, these knives have a full tang which makes them robust and eases hand fatigue.

Constructed from AUS-8A stainless steel, each blade is subjected to 3 chamfering processes. This special grinding process reduces the friction against food and blade and gives you a knife with an extremely sharp cutting edge. Like others in the Kai family, the handle is made from hard-wearing PakkaWood which enables durability and comfort, as well as making it an attractive looking knife to have in your collection.

  • Blade Material: Full tang, Japanese AUS-8A blade steel
  • Cutting Angle: Double bevelled 16° cutting angle on each side.
  • Hardness: 60 HRC.
  • Handle Material: PakkaWood (premium, resin-impregnated hardwood)
  • Blade length: 12cm
  • Handcrafted in Japan
